The nurse in a community clinic recognizes that older women face various barriers to obtaining health care
Which of the following are barriers that must be overcome? Note: Credit will only be given if all correct and no incorrect choices are selected. Select all that apply. 1. Transportation difficulties
2. Lack of private health care coverage
3. Excessive medical costs not covered by Medicare
4. Adequate research on chronic conditions
5. The Family and Medical Leave Act
1, 2, 3
Explanation: 1. Older women can face multiple barriers when obtaining healthcare services, and difficulty with transportation is one of them.
2. Older women can face multiple barriers when obtaining healthcare services, and lack of private health coverage is one of them.
3. Older women can face multiple barriers when obtaining health-care services, and excessive medical costs not covered by Medicare is one of them.
